Effects of attending to a 12-week structured physical activity program on fitness and self-perception levels of obese primary schoolchildren
Introduction: Childhood obesity is a major health problem especially for schoolchildren both physically and mentally. The study was conducted to assess the effects of the structured physical activity (PA) program on the physical fitness (PF) and self-perception levels of obese schoolchildren. Materi...
